Many people think budgeting is simply about tracking their past spending but knowing what you’ve already spent doesn’t help you to plan for the future. At Budget Pro, we firmly believe budgeting isn’t about looking backwards – it’s about planning ahead. When you have a clear plan for your money, it puts you in control of every pound - reducing financial stress and putting you on track to reach your financial goals.
